Product Introduction

ε-Polylysine is a biodegradable, non-toxic polypeptide derived from the fermentation of the bacterium Streptomyces albulus. It is composed of lysine amino acids linked together in a specific sequence, which gives it its unique properties. ε-Polylysine is commonly utilized in the food industry for its antimicrobial properties, helping to extend the shelf life of various food products by preventing the growth of bacteria and fungi. It can also serve as a preservative in cosmetics and personal care products, where it helps maintain product integrity.

Production Process

The production of ε-polylysine begins with the fermentation of Streptomyces albulus in a nutrient-rich medium, where the bacteria synthesize the ε-polylysine as a byproduct. Following fermentation, the product undergoes several purification steps to isolate the ε-polylysine from the fermentation broth. These steps typically include filtration, precipitation, and drying, resulting in a fine powder that retains its antimicrobial efficacy.

Product Application Scenarios

ε-Polylysine is applied in various food products, including sauces, meats, and baked goods, where it acts to inhibit spoilage microorganisms. In the pharmaceutical industry, it is used as a preservative for certain medications and supplements. It is also found in cosmetic formulations, contributing to the preservation of creams, lotions, and other personal care items. Its versatility makes it a valuable ingredient in extending the functional life of a range of products.
